【摘要】 研究型大学对学生科研思维的培养至关重要,有机化学实验作为近化学专业类学生重要的基础实验课程,对学生操作技能、创新能力和科研思维培养有重要作用。本文以非化学专业本科生有机化学实验"大学化学实验(O)"的教学实践为例,从学生学习方式、教师教学方法、实验教学内容设置等方面阐述如何在教学过程中完成对学生科研思维的培养。

【Abstract】 It is very important for research-oriented universities to cultivate students’ scientific thinking. As an important basic course for non-chemistry major students with specialty related to chemistry, organic chemistry laboratory teaching plays an important role in cultivating students’ operational skills, innovative ability, and scientific research thinking. Taking the teaching practice of the "College Chemistry Laboratory(O)" for non-chemical undergraduates as an example, this paper discusses how to complete the cultivation of students’ scientific research thinking in the teaching process from the aspects of students’ learning style, teachers’ teaching methods, and laboratory-teaching content.
